
Daniel Pardo
Daniel Pardo is a journalist associated with BBC News, recognized for his reporting on significant events and figures related to Colombia's drug trade. His work often delves into the historical and political contexts of narcotrafficking, providing insightful analysis and commentary on the evolving dynamics of the country's drug-related issues.
